Предпоследняя скобка - лишняя. По первичному ключу уже есть такое значение. И попробуйте названия полей взять в обратные кавычки `.
Кроме кнопки общего кеша, попробуйте обновить, нажав на ссылки - http://floomby.ru/s2/jWbzJu
$('.active').click(function () {
заменить на
$('.active + a').click(function () {
$replace_1[] = " <div align=\"center\"> <hr class=\"att_hr\"/> <div id=\"attachment\"><a href=\"{$config['http_home_url']}engine/download.php?id={$row['id']}{$area}\" >Скачать <b>{$row['name']}</b></a></div> <div id=\"attachment2\">Размер: <span>{$size} </span> Скачиваний: <span>{$row['dcount']} </span></div> </div> "; $replace_2[] = " <div align=\"center\"> <hr class=\"att_hr\"/> <div id=\"attachment\"><a href=\"{$config['http_home_url']}engine/download.php?id={$row['id']}{$area}\" >Скачать <b>{$row['name']}</b></a></div> <div id=\"attachment2\">Размер: <span>{$size} </span> Скачиваний: <span>{$row['dcount']} </span></div> </div> ";
/*---Ссылка на скачивание прикрепленного файла---*/ /*---Полоса с названием файла---*/ #attachment { text-align:center; border:1px solid #000; border-radius:3px; background: #013027; color: #808080; width:500px; padding:2px; float:center; min-height:20px; box-shadow: 1px 1px 2px #000; } #attachment a {color: #ccc; text-shadow: 5px 5px 10px #fff; } /*---Показатели файла (размер и скачано)---*/ #attachment2{ text-align:center; text-shadow: 5px 5px 5px #013027; color:#000; margin-top:5px; font-weight:700; } #attachment2 span{color:#ff0000;} /*---Кнопка на скачивание в всплывшем окне---*/ #attachment3 { text-align:center; border:1px solid #000; border-radius:3px; background: #013027; padding:2px; float:center; box-shadow: 1px 1px 2px #000; margin:7px 0px 0px 0px; } #attachment3 a {font:40px bold; color: #ccc; text-shadow: 5px 5px 10px #fff; } .att_hr{width:300px; margin:18px 0px;}
В fullstory.tpl добавить
<script>
$("#attachment").click(function() {
$(this).children("a").trigger("click");
});
</script>
CSS
#attachment {
cursor: pointer;
....
Например, картинки масштабируются браузером, лучше их скриптом сжимать. Картинка грузится с разрешением 800px, а выводится в разрешении 200px.
Если сайт интересен, то полезно.
Например, как тут - http://jelu.ru/2013/02/42.html
В функции createInstallmonsterDownloadLink при создании ссылки добавлять класс. И уже по этому классу искать ссылку и получать ее атрибут href. Затем уже переход по ссылке через location.href.
Подсказки как в например, в гугле когда начинаешь набирать, такое хотите?
Можно добавить проверку значения из note_update.php и если все нормально, тогда менять картинку.